Output d592cc853d2186a67a97921e9a97cd58063c365c31636dd5d1af23cb243eb732:0

value
15739386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d17163712fba14931a6cd65f8ff4b2290feb6b7 OP_EQUAL
address
MEvmvJGfptgaKQ5hHi7dsTdXZNqKibnsiL
transaction
d592cc853d2186a67a97921e9a97cd58063c365c31636dd5d1af23cb243eb732
spent
true